Features and Benefits

Bottoming chamfers are used for threading blind holes. They have 1 to 2 threads.
V is a multi-layered TiCN coating that is harder and has greater wear resistance than TiN. It is used for applications in cast iron, steel, stainless steel, nickel alloys and aluminum. V is a proprietary coating exclusive to OSG Tap and Die, Inc.

Features and Benefits

Modified bottoming chamfers are similar to bottoming chamfers, but they are longer and have more teeth. They are used for threading blind holes and have 2 to 2-1/2 threads.
Cobalt is harder than high speed steel and provides better wear resistance. It is commonly used on high tensile alloys.
Hardlube is a multi-layered coating composed of titanium aluminum nitride and tungsten carbide/carbon (TiAIN/WC/C). It is stronger and more wear resistant than TIAlN. It is commonly used on steel, stainless steel, nickel and cobalt.
Fast Spiral Flutes with 40-53 degree angles are suitable for ductile materials like aluminum and copper; medium to high carbon steels and free machining stainless steels.
